I had a brief living situation in which I was possibly able to get dial-up internet service. It was going to be rough using dial-up, but it was better than nothing, so I called earthlink. The gentleman told me that they had a special offer that gave me 1 month free with an option to cancel, or I could continue for 5 more months at 8.99 per month, and then, thereafter, I would pay the regular monthly service charge. Knowing I was to be there for less than a month, I agreed to the free trial, then after I moved, I could perhaps switch to DSL with earthlink and keep my email... well...
The trial ended, I didn't need their continued service and so I did not renew or take them up on their 5 month reduced rate. They said they would cancel my account.
Now, I know it's not best practice, but there is no law that allows any company I have done business with previously, to have withdrawal rights on my account and get away with it if I don't catch them right away. But, this is exactly what Earthlink does. I didn't look closely at my account statements... mainly because I went green and chose to get paperless statements. Needless to say, I don't check my statements as much now except when there is a big problem. 8.99 a month was not big enough to be alarming to me.
Earthlink continued with the additional promotion for the next 5 months, and then they changed my status to full monthly payments of 29.99 per month for the next year and a half. I was livid when I finally discovered it. It took me 2 hours on the live chat link arguing with a lady rep. who kept trying to sell me a better deal... mind you, I don't live there anymore, nor do I own the account that I access the internet on, so I should not be paying for monthly access. I refused and so she told me in that case I was overdue for the last month's payment!!! When I refused to pay, I got a bill for 2 months plus a penalty adding up to 60 some dollars. I decided that my time was worth more than that so I will pay it yet again and be done with it.
I followed their procedures to pay online and when I pressed "submit" I got a message that the transaction failed. I was then redirected to the payment area to start over. I did. This time it worked. I immediately called Earthlink to inform them of this mishap and asked that they insure me that I won't be billed twice and to please cancel services. Eventually, I was assured I wouldn't be charged twice, and that the account was cancelled.
They made me feel relieved that my account was at last free from their greedy suction and I fell for it, until I remembered, they have taken more than 5oo.oo from me due to their own mistake! When I mentioned that, the reply was, "I can't help you with that part, ma'am, " then rattled off my confirmation number.
Months later, I discovered an Earthlink Charge on my other bank account! It was not my account. I looked in the archives of my bank acct. and discovered that they were doing the same thing to my other account and it had been going on for 2.5 years at 9.99 to 21.99 per month. I called to tell them that this one was fraudulent and they kept referring back to my previous case. The rep could not find any record of my checking account number and suggested I call my bank and request a 6-month stop payment. I didn't know that you can't get your bank to just stop paying on accounts even if they are not yours. they just tell you that 6 months is usually enough time to get them to cancel you.
The stop payment was to cost 3o.00 for the service. Infuriated with that, I called Earthlink again (which is not an easy task if you don't have an account with them) and spent the next 1 hour and 20 minutes arguing with a man who did not speak english well and did not help me at all. Finally, he passed me on to another person, and the whole damn routine started over, yet again. He cancelled the account after 1 hour and 20 minutes, which I recorded every minute of, and told me that he could not reimburse any of the nearly 400.00 they have pilfered from my account, but he would put a note on the account stating that I was wrongfully billed.
